 Plant extract refers to a product formed by using plants as raw materials, according to the needs of the final product use, through an extraction and separation process, directional acquisition or concentration of one or more components in the plant, generally without changing the original components of the plant. If necessary, it can be supplemented with excipients to make powder or granular products with good fluidity and anti-hygroscopicity, but there are also a small amount of liquid or oily products.
Chinese medicine formula granule: It is made by water extraction, concentration, drying and granulation of Chinese medicine decoction pieces. After the clinical prescription of traditional Chinese medicine is determined, it can be taken by the patient. Chinese medicine formula granules are a supplement to Chinese medicine decoction pieces. Medicinal materials extracted from traditional Chinese medicine or natural plants: refers to a single active ingredient with a clear active ingredient and a content of more than 90%, which can be used as a raw material for a traditional Chinese medicine preparation with a drug approval number; it is extracted and separated from traditional Chinese medicine or natural plants , Can be used as the main raw material of chemical preparations, the products are: chloroplast, paclitaxel, camptothecin.
 Standardized Chinese medicine plant extracts: Refers to the volatile oils, fats, extracts, extracts, dry extracts, active ingredients, effective parts and other ingredients in the standard prescriptions of Chinese patent medicines. There are separate national medicine standards for the production of Chinese patent medicines. Mainly refers to the extracts of traditional Chinese medicine contained in the "plant oil and extract" item in the Pharmacopoeia.

Plant essential oil is a kind of aromatic oil liquid extracted from plants. At present, there are more than 3000 kinds of plant essential oils in my country, of which about 300 kinds of plant essential oils have important commercial value. In addition to being used as perfume, plant essential oil is also a natural antibacterial material that can kill bacteria, fungi and viruses. Plant essential oils are widely used in the daily chemical industry (perfume, cosmetics, moisturizing cream, soap, air freshener, antiseptic, etc.), medicine, food and beverage, feed (such as oregano oil), pest control, etc. due to their fragrance and antibacterial effect. . China is the world's largest producer and exporter of Litsea cubeba essential oil, accounting for about 70% of the international market.
